China vs USA: Should Trump ban open-source AI?

A fierce debate is taking place between Silicon Valley and Washington right now. After the release of KIMI K3 – China’s cheaper and powerful AI model – the Trump administration is showing signs of restricting open-source AI to maintain control over the technology. Danny Fortson and Mark Sellman, Tech Correspondent for The Times, discuss why tech bosses are worried, what it could mean for America’s lead in AI and whether open-source models could speed up the race to superintelligence. They also hear from Connor Leahy, CEO of AI safety research company Conjecture, who explains why frontier AI isn't just a superpower – it’s a superweapon. Should Trump ban open-source models?
